Two restaurants have been awarded a second star: Bon-Bon in Brussels and Bartholomeus in Knokke-Heist (West Flanders). Bon-Bon restaurant is run by Christophe Hardiquest (executive chef) and his wife Stéphanie (restaurant manager). Michelin praises chef Christophe Hardiquest's creativity, his technical skill and his use of top-quality ingredients.
Executive chef at Bartholomeus is Bart Desmit. Michelin is impressed by Desmit's refined dishes that showcase an outstanding balance of flavours.
Restaurant Danny Horseele in Bruges has lost its two stars. The two-star restaurant was declared bankrupt in July 2013. However, chef Danny Horseele gains back one star in the 2014 guide with his new restaurant in Ghent named 'Horseele'. The restaurant, that opened end of August 2013, is located at the Ghent football stadium Gelamco Arena. Italian restaurant Mosconi in Luxembourg has been demoted to one star. The 2014 guide will feature 17 two-star restaurants in total, all in Belgium.
No changes in Michelin's highest category. The number of three-star restaurants in Belgium still stands at 3: De Karmeliet in Bruges (chef: Geert Van Hecke), Hertog Jan in Bruges (chef: Gert De Mangeleer) and Hof van Cleve in Kruishoutem (chef: Peter Goossens).

Michelin has awarded 18 restaurants in Belgium one star, of which 12 are located in Flanders, 2 in Brussels and 4 in Wallonia. Among the winners are Villa Lorraine and Restaurant WY, both in Brussels; Restaurant Vrijmoed in Ghent; The Glorious Winebar & Bistro and l'Epicerie du Cirque, both in Antwerp. The number of one-star restaurants in Belgium now stands at 101.
In the 2014 guide Luxembourg gets 1 new one-star restaurant: Restaurant Becher Gare in Bech. The 2014 Belgium and Luxembourg guide will feature 11 one-star restaurants in Luxembourg.
The results of the 2014 Bib Gourmand Benelux guide (Belgium, Luxembourg and the Netherlands) were announced by Michelin on November 4th. In the sixth edition of the Benelux guide Belgium has 143 entries and Luxembourg has 12, with 23 new entries for Belgium and 5 new entries for Luxembourg.
